Garth Brooks has broken his Seattle-Tacoma, WA ticket sales record. His previous record was set July 15th -20th, 1998 with 85,490 tickets sold for Seattle Center in Seattle, WA. As of Friday (Sept 29th), he has broken that record with over 86,000 tickets sold for the Tacoma Dome and tickets are still selling.

It’s Garth’s first time in the Seattle-Tacoma area in 19 years. The tour is presented by Amazon Music Unlimited.

The Garth Brooks World Tour with Trisha Yearwood has sold more than 5.91 million tickets since its launch in Chicago in September 2014. The tour wraps in Nashville sometime in December. Final cities on the three year North American trek include Indianapolis, a one off return to Atlanta, Lincoln and Spokane.
